Remember Jeremy Butler?
Similar type of reliable, steady, if unspectacular, possession receiver who runs decent enough routes. Though our Jeremy was taller, as Kerley is only about 5' 9''.
Was the 49ers leading WR when they had nothing else there other than Torrey, becoming Blaine Gabbert's favorite option.

Kerley is a small receiver with return skills and some decent speed. He’s 5’9” 180-185lbs. He’s had some nice plays here and there. Wouldn’t be a bad depth option.
